# AS400 Terminal Install & Setup Instructions
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Install MacOS
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
For the iMac model, use the following OSX releases: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
> **A1195 (White Bezel)** - OSX 10.6 Snow Leopard (*10.4 Tiger* to *10.7 Lion*)
|
||||||
|
>
|
||||||
|
> **A1208 (White Bezel)** - OSX 10.6 Snow Leopard (*10.4 Tiger* to *10.7 Lion*)
|
||||||
|
>
|
||||||
|
> **A1224 (Silver Bezel)** - OSX 10.10 Yosemite (*10.5 Leopard* to *10.11 El Capitan*)
|
||||||
|
>
|
||||||
|
> **A1418 (Silverback)** - OSX 10.14 Mojave (*10.8 Mountain Lion* to *10.15 Catalina*)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- During install, split into 2 partitions. Format partition 1 as AFS or HFS. Format partition 2 as Fat32 (Apple refers to Fat32 as just FAT).
|
||||||
|
- Install the *next to most recent* version of OSX instead of the most recent onto partition 1.
|
||||||
|
- Shut down, then hold option after pressing the power button to choose the startup drive to select the Lubuntu install USB drive.

## Install Lubuntu
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Boot to the Lubuntu USB drive and choose Try Lubuntu.
|
||||||
|
- Once loaded, click the start menu -> **System Tools** -> **KDE Partition Manager**.
|
||||||
|
- In the partition manager, select the Fat32 partition and click delete. Then click apply and close the partition manager.
|
||||||
|
- Double click the install Lubuntu icon from the desktop.
|
||||||
|
- The user name should be terminal (lowercase). For computer name, I used "terminal-MODELMMYY" (ex. terminal-A11950924)
|
||||||
|
- Make sure to select the option to not require login when creating the user.

### Run setup script
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Open the terminal
|
||||||
|
- For Lubuntu 18, it is LXTerminal: **Start** -> **System Tools** -> **LXTerminal**
|
||||||
|
- For Lubuntu 24, it is QTerminal: **Start** -> **System Tools** -> **QTerminal**
|
||||||
|
- At the terminal prompt, type the following:
|
||||||
|
> `cd ~/Desktop/temp`
|
||||||
|
>
|
||||||
|
> `sudo chmod +x install*.sh`
|
||||||
|
>
|
||||||
|
> For 32-Bit systems (A1195 & A1208): `sudo ./install32.sh`
|
||||||
|
>
|
||||||
|
> For 64-Bit systems (A1224 & A1418): `sudo ./install64.sh`
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This installs prerequisites*, JAVA (1.8.0_381), ODBC (2.3.12), IBM iAccess (v1r9), and other configuration files. It should ask you to answer a few questions once it starts installing the IBM software. Answer them all Yes.

### Disable Power Management
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Open the Power Management console
|
||||||
|
- Lubuntu 18: **Start** -> **Preferences** -> **Power Manager**
|
||||||
|
- Security Tab
|
||||||
|
- Change Slide all slider to the left so it says never
|
||||||
|
- Click on the Security tab
|
||||||
|
- Click the box next to "Automatically lock the session" and change it to Never
|
||||||
|
- Click Close at the bottom
|
||||||
|
- Lubuntu 24: **Start** -> **Preferences** -> **LXQt Settings** -> **Power Management**
|
||||||
|
- Click the Idle section
|
||||||
|
- Uncheck the "Enable Idleness Watcher" option at the top.
|
||||||
|
- Optionally, disable the screensaver at **Start** -> **Preferences** -> **XScreenSaver Settings**
